About This Funder

The Sussex Historic Churches Trust is a heritage preservation body founded in 1956 to safeguard architecturally and historically significant places of worship for future generations, driven by values of stewardship, community continuity, civic identity, and inclusive faith heritage protection across all denominations. Its grantmaking philosophy emphasizes pragmatic intervention to avert irretrievable loss of sacred buildings through evidence-led support for urgent structural repairs, prioritizing professional conservation practices, faculty-approved works, and the ongoing vitality of worship spaces as community anchors. Believing that well-maintained historic fabric sustains both spiritual life and cultural cohesion, the Trust partners with congregations demonstrating genuine need and heritage rationale.

It funds essential conservation activities including reroofing, masonry renovation, spire and tower repairs, weatherproofing, and fabric restoration for places of worship at least 100 years old, addressing chronic dilapidation, underinvestment risks, and threats of closure that undermine active worship and communal gatherings. Supported interventions focus on structural renewal of churches, chapels, and sacred sites of Anglican and non-Anglican traditions, enabling continued use for religious services, community events, and cultural heritage preservation. Beneficiaries encompass local congregations maintaining these irreplaceable landmarks, alongside broader rural and urban communities deriving social cohesion, historical continuity, and identity from preserved ecclesiastical architecture, with emphasis on buildings listed for exceptional heritage value in active settings.

Exclusions encompass routine maintenance, non-fabric improvements, internal modernisations, modern facilities, non-worship spaces, and projects lacking proven historical or architectural significance or expert-assessed urgency.
